Olmo's Barcelona Move Blocked Again: A Transfer Saga Continues

The protracted transfer saga surrounding Dani Olmo and FC Barcelona continues to dominate headlines, with yet another roadblock seemingly emerging in the path of a potential Camp Nou move. While the Spanish international midfielder has long been linked with a return to his homeland, a combination of financial constraints, fierce competition, and potentially differing valuations are preventing a deal from materializing. This article delves deep into the complexities of the situation, examining the factors hindering Olmo's move and exploring the potential outcomes.

Financial Hurdles: Barcelona's Tight Budget

Barcelona's precarious financial situation remains the elephant in the room. The club's well-documented debt and ongoing struggles to comply with La Liga's financial fair play regulations severely limit their spending power. Even if Barcelona were to reach an agreement with RB Leipzig on a transfer fee, registering Olmo with La Liga could prove immensely challenging. The club needs to significantly reduce its wage bill and generate substantial revenue before they can afford to bring in a player of Olmo's caliber. This isn't merely a matter of securing the transfer fee; it's about navigating the labyrinthine regulations imposed by the Spanish league authorities.

The Impact of Financial Fair Play

La Liga's strict financial fair play rules are designed to prevent clubs from overspending and becoming financially unstable. These rules dictate a complex formula that considers not only transfer fees but also players' wages, existing contracts, and overall revenue generation. Barcelona needs to significantly improve their financial position before they can even think about registering new high-earning players, regardless of the transfer fee agreed upon with RB Leipzig. This underscores the criticality of the financial aspect in Olmo's potential transfer.
